Relatively compound terms aside, Inconel 718 is merely a heat resistance metal that keeps high temperatures without much damage. The alloy is made of various components such as nickel, chromium, and molybdenum. All these parts perform very vital function in making the Inconel 718 stronger and helpful within the arduous situations. These unique ingredients are what makes Inconel 718 perfect for use in high heat and pressure environments.

Some metals will begin to fracture or spring when heated up most. But Inconel 718 is different! It also can sustain its strength and hardness when it is heated to extremely high temperatures. Which is why you will find Inconel 718 trusted to keep on working when the going gets hot in industries such as aerospace and gas engines.
